More than 10 years collecting, every single day I take a look over ebay, I have a "Boss silver screw" (newly listed) search in my browser's favorite.
It's not unusual to do a search over ebay 2 or 3 times a day, it's fast and easy.
I only saw 3 SD-1 silver screws, one is the one I bought, one was another 0300 and one was a 0400.
